I just received my latest Rare Coin Market Report magazine from PCGS and included was a really nifty 2008 calendar. It's got 12 full color pictures of coins from award winning registry sets. The photographs are, unsurprisingly, really nice and range from a 1949 quarter to 1798 dollar to a J-111 pattern to a 1966 half dollar to ... . Plus on the last pages the calendar lists the names of all the 2007 registry set award winners. A very, very nice job. I sure know what will be gracing the wall in my coin area for the entire next year!
